The Anatomy of Your Vehicle’s Door Assembly

The car door is far more than just a piece of metal and glass; it is a housing for an intricate system of mechanical and electrical components. When you disassemble a door panel, you will find a variety of car door parts that facilitate everything from locking your vehicle to sound insulation. Recognizing these parts is the first step in diagnosing why a handle might feel loose, why a window won't roll down, or why your door lock actuator is making an unusual buzzing sound.
Here are the primary components housed within most standard vehicle doors:
- Door Handles: Both interior and exterior handles are the primary interface for users, connected to the latch assembly via cables or metal rods.
- Door Latches and Strikers: These are the critical safety components that keep the door closed. The latch hooks onto the striker bolted to the vehicle frame.
- Window Regulators and Motors: These parts facilitate the vertical movement of your windows. Modern cars almost exclusively use electric motors for this task.
- Door Lock Actuators: Small electrical devices that move the lock mechanism to the "locked" or "unlocked" position upon your command.
- Weatherstripping and Seals: Rubber components that prevent rain, wind, and noise from entering the cabin.
- Hinges and Check Straps: These support the weight of the door and control how far the door opens, preventing it from swinging shut unexpectedly.
Common Signs of Failing Door Components
Because these parts are used thousands of times throughout the life of a vehicle, they eventually experience material fatigue. Ignoring minor symptoms can often lead to more expensive repairs later on. For instance, a worn-out window regulator can put unnecessary strain on the motor, potentially burning it out if the window becomes jammed.
| Symptom | Potential Culprit |
|---|---|
| Door handle feels limp or does not open | Broken cable or disconnected rod |
| Window moves slowly or makes grinding noise | Worn window regulator or debris in tracks |
| Door rattles while driving | Loose striker or worn hinge bushings |
| Lock won't respond to the key fob | Faulty door lock actuator or fuse |
⚠️ Note: When working with internal car door parts, always disconnect the negative battery terminal before handling electrical components like window motors or lock actuators to prevent short circuits.
Best Practices for Maintenance and Replacement

Regular maintenance can significantly extend the longevity of your car door parts. Simple actions like lubricating hinges and checking the condition of rubber seals can prevent the accumulation of dirt and moisture, which are the primary enemies of mechanical assemblies.
When it comes time to replace a faulty part, follow these systematic steps:
- Source Quality Replacements: Always look for parts that meet OEM specifications. Cheap aftermarket parts may fail prematurely, requiring you to disassemble the door again.
- Use Proper Tools: Most door panels are held by plastic clips. Use a dedicated trim removal tool to avoid damaging the panel or paint.
- Test Before Reassembly: Before snapping the door panel back into place, test the electronic components (locks and windows) and the mechanical release to ensure everything is aligned correctly.
💡 Note: Take photos of the internal wiring and rod connections before detaching them. This will serve as a visual map during the reassembly process.
Troubleshooting Electronic Door Issues
Modern vehicles rely heavily on electronic car door parts. If your power locks or windows stop functioning, the problem isn't always the mechanical part itself. Often, the issue lies in the wiring harness that passes between the door and the body of the car. Because this harness flexes every time the door opens and closes, the internal wires can become brittle and break over time.
If you suspect an electrical fault:
- Check the interior fuse box to see if a fuse related to the door modules has blown.
- Inspect the wiring harness located within the rubber boot between the door hinge and the vehicle frame.
- Use a multimeter to test if the actuator or motor is receiving power when you trigger the switch.
